Default Got 100% of my bank charges back from Co-op

I've just found a credit from the Co-operative Bank refunding ALL my bank charges over the last 3 months - to the last penny...

All it took was ONE letter and 3 weeks - they didn't even get in touch, they just did it! I'm quite chuffed...

The key paragraph I included went like this...

"I cannot afford these charges and believe they are disproportionate to the actual cost to you. If you disagree, please provide a full breakdown of the costs..... bank charges are not legally enforceable and the Office of Fair Trading ruled on April 6th 2006 that such expensive penalties are 'unfair'. Penalty clauses in contracts in English law for breach of contract aren’t legal if the penalty exceeds the actual cost of the breach of either party. Your charges therefore breach the 1977 Unfair Terms Act and the 1999 Consumer Credit Act. "
